CARPIO, María Belén. INTERACTION OF NOMINAL POSSESSION AND NUMBER IN TOBA ÑACHILAMOLEʔK: GUAYCURUAN FAMILY, FORMOSA, ARGENTINA. Lingüística [online]. 2012, vol.28, n.1, pp.99-118. ISSN 2079-312X.

In this paper, I analyze the syntagmatic co-occurence of possession and number affixes in the possessed nouns in the variety of Toba spoken in Western Formosa or Toba Ñachilamoleʔk. First, I present number and possessive affixes in paradigmatic terms, and then I describe the syntagmatic interaction of them. I demonstrate that when the possessor is second person plural the affix ordering is: 2possessor-possessed noun-plural.possessed-2plural.possessor. The number morpheme occurs next to the nominal core followed by the plural of the possessor. When the possessor is third person plural, the co-occurence of the morphemes that encode plurality of the possessor and of the possessed noun was not attested

Keywords : affix ordering; plural possessed entities; plural possessors.
